Transaction 75eba9f8dfd0297dbb326e639ab905f5206d67f56c15680f64a19f8919891ae2
1 Input
1 Output
-
75eba9f8dfd0297dbb326e639ab905f5206d67f56c15680f64a19f8919891ae2:0
- value
- 443988
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eb88bc25b4f520628ffe30304669ba3556c76c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16idyNT1dLTUj7r8jc4J8hcWBYhTbKX4VJ